We are looking for a FullStack QA Tech Lead to join either the Compliance or Finance team and help us scale quality engineering across the Back Office Domain. This is a hands-on technical leadership role. The QA Tech Lead is attached to a product team and keeps half time hands-on contribution, while also owning domain-level QA consistency, quality standards adoption, technical risk visibility, and testing strategy. About the domain The Back Office domain includes several teams which are working on the internal platforms that support compliance, financial operations, risk control, and product administration. The domain focuses on automation, operational efficiency, regulatory readiness, auditability, and safe execution of critical business processes across products and regions.
Responsibilities:
Be an active part of a Scrum product team and keep around 50% hands-on contribution
Do requirements analysis, test design, manual and automated testing for backend/API, UI, integrations, message queues, and complex business flows
Develop and maintain test documentation
Automate test cases and improve regression coverage using the existing Python-based framework
Maintain and expand the test automation framework, including mocks, test data, CI/CD integration, and reporting
Analyze failed test runs, perform RCA, report defects, and help the team improve product quality
Participate in release activities, smoke testing, production validation, and post-release monitoring
Own QA technical direction for the team and help scale consistent QA practices across the Back Office Domain
Improve QA processes, quality gates, automation strategy, and delivery confidence together with QA, Dev, DevOps, Product, and Engineering Manager
Mentor QA engineers, support code/test case reviews, and help grow QA engineering maturity in the team.
